Most mature trees benefit from professional trimming every 3-5 years, but it depends on the species, age, and condition of your trees. Fast-growing trees like maples might need attention more often, while slower-growing oaks can go longer between trimmings. Dead, diseased, or damaged branches should be removed immediately regardless of when the tree was last trimmed. A professional assessment can determine the right schedule for your specific trees and help you avoid both over-pruning and neglecting necessary maintenance.
Late fall through early spring is typically ideal for most tree species in Pennsylvania, when trees are dormant and won’t experience stress from pruning. However, dead or dangerous branches should be removed any time of year for safety reasons. Some trees, like maples, are best pruned in late summer to avoid excessive sap bleeding. Emergency storm damage obviously can’t wait for the perfect season. The key is understanding which trees can be safely pruned when, and professional arborists know these timing considerations for different species.
Tree trimming costs vary based on tree size, number of branches being removed, accessibility, and complexity of the job. Small trees might cost a few hundred dollars, while large mature trees requiring extensive work can cost significantly more. Emergency storm damage typically costs more than scheduled maintenance. The best approach is getting a detailed estimate that breaks down exactly what work will be performed. Reputable tree services provide free estimates and explain their pricing clearly, so you know what you’re paying for before any work begins.
Insurance coverage depends on why the trimming is needed. Preventive maintenance and routine tree care typically aren’t covered, but storm damage removal often is covered under most homeowner’s policies. If a tree damages your home or other structures, that’s usually covered. However, if a tree falls without causing property damage, removal might not be covered. It’s worth checking with your insurance company about your specific coverage. Some insurers even offer discounts for proactive tree maintenance that reduces the risk of storm damage claims.
Small branches within easy reach can often be handled by homeowners with proper tools and techniques, but large branches require professional equipment and expertise. Improper cuts can damage trees permanently, and working with heavy branches near power lines or structures is dangerous. Large branches can fall unpredictably and cause serious injury or property damage. Professional arborists have the training, equipment, and insurance to handle big jobs safely. The cost of professional trimming is usually much less than the potential cost of injuries, property damage, or tree replacement from DIY mistakes.
Start with proper licensing and insurance – any legitimate tree service should readily provide proof of both. Look for companies with local experience who understand your area’s climate and common tree species. Get detailed written estimates that specify exactly what work will be performed, and be wary of door-to-door solicitors or unusually low bids. Good tree services clean up completely and don’t leave a mess behind. References from recent local customers can give you confidence in their work quality and reliability. Professional equipment and safety practices are also important indicators of a company you can trust.
